Private real estate financing helps investors purchase, fix up or refinance a property utilizing a short-term mortgage from a private business or an individual. Although conventional lending institutions, for example, banks necessitate an extended, time consuming application process and in all likelihood will think twice about giving money to a self-employed applicant, private mortgage loans in close fast and are easy qualifying.

Thus, even if you have bad credit, having a real estate opportunity with good potential, a substantial downpayment, past experience in real estate, and a well-defined exit strategy are far more crucial when qualifying for private money for a real estate loan. Most individuals work with Unalakleet private mortgage lenders when:

  1. A remodeling job or renovation can help to sell the home for a higher price point or charge significantly more rent.

    One example is a client who held a two-unit rental property. He'd already built up ample equity in the asset and the rent was a routine revenue stream. Though a few upgrades to the property could have enabled him to command higher rent, a bank would most likely have turned down his loan request, due to the fact his credit score was merely 520. So he reached out to Read Rock Capital to do a cash-out refinance and acquired a loan at 65% LTV.

  2. They've got multiple debts and wish to combine them.

    Multiple unsecured debts with a range of lending rates can be extremely overwhelming and challenging to keep tabs on. Due to this, lots of people do a loan from a property's equity to merge all their financial debts into one single manageable payment.

  3. They would like to use their property's equity for a different real estate deal.

    One of Island View's clients in Hawaii had a house valued at $1.2 million. He wanted to sell the house but that did not work out and he finally was forced to be satisfied with leasing the property, with an option to purchase it at a future date. The money that stemmed from the rent paid for his ongoing mortgage payment, home owner's insurance, and taxes. He also was given a two hundred thousand dollars non-refundable deposit for the 3 year agreement. With these assurances to pay for the home's foreseeable expenses, he stumbled on a new real estate opportunity and got in touch with Read Rock Capital for a private mortgage loan close to seventy percent of the home's appraised value. The money helped him afford his next investment property and in addition, pay off his primary mortgage.

  4. They want help to meet the balloon payment for the existing private loan.

    A person who invests in real estate and has a previous private mortgage and cannot afford the balloon payment as a result of a change in circumstances can apply for refinancing from a different lending company. Refinancing prior to the term date helps you to meet the deadline for the balloon payment and avert any penalties in connection with failing to make the balloon payment.
